Description
Rugged, warm, and windproof, Iron Heart's heavyweight flannel shirts are a staple of every fall/winter collection. This season, they've introduced the new “Rider’s” cut, designed with heavy-duty hardware and a roomier, boxy fit for heavy layering. Built for the open road, features include a two-way zipper beneath a snap-fastened over-placket for enhanced wind resistance, large secure chest pockets, and heavy-duty copper snaps throughout—offering motorcyclists the warmth and comfort of a flannel, with the functionality of a jacket.
In Iron Heart's efforts to explore more sustainable alternatives to the Aspero cotton used for our traditional ultra heavy flannel (UHF) shirts, this model is cut from a new 10oz Japanese heavyweight flannel. Softer and slightly lighter than its Aspero counterparts, Iron Heart has heavily brushed the reverse of the fabric to increase thickness and improve heat retention. While the 10oz weave means it's not a UHF shirt, weight isn’t everything; this fabric still delivers the warmth, comfort and rugged characteristics that Iron Heart's heavyweight winter flannels are renowned for.
